Subject: String extraction cut-over done

Future maintainers: the Lexibin translation-string extraction script has been cut over from the old Perl tool to the new Phrasemill extractor. All source packages were re-scanned and the output matched the legacy catalogue except for twelve stale entries, which we dropped. Extraction now runs in CI on every merge rather than nightly. The extractor reads its settings from the block below.

service settings:
[casax]
port = 6379
team = rusir
host = casax.zemvarhq.corp
region = outer-4
access_code = ac_9808ce
timeout_ms = 1500

## Deployment

The Corvane gateway enforces per-client rate limits at the edge pods before requests reach upstream services. On-call engineers should never raise limits live without paging the Fenwick team, as bursts can saturate the shared queue. Rollouts apply settings atomically per region. The production values currently deployed are listed below.

deployment values, yadug-bawif:
[framir]
team = pelox
access_code = ac_a38ab2
owner = tamion.julael
host = framir.tolvaqlabs.test
port = 11211
peer = tammir.zemvargrid.local
salt = 2215ef03
pin = 1541

Every Tidecrank release is traceable from source commit to deployed artifact. The autoscaler's scaling policy is compiled into the binary, so release managers must confirm that the deployed image matches the reviewed policy revision before promotion. Provenance records are generated at build time and sealed by the Millgate signing service; any mismatch between the attestation and the running image halts the rollout automatically. To verify a given deployment, compare the attestation digest against the trace token below.

build token for kagaf-hahof: htk14_9d3d4d26d7d8de